We really need to take the time to appreciate how blessed we are! To be grateful for our families, church families and friends, and to show them how much we care. It's too easy to be too busy and not take the time to really live our lives as God intends. He says in the Gospel of John:

John 10:10
The thief cometh not, but for to steal, and to kill, and to destroy: I am come that they might have life, and that they might have it more abundantly.(KJV)

The Amplified Bible says:

John 10:10
The thief comes only in order to steal and kill and destroy. I came that they may have and enjoy life, and have it in abundance (to the full, till it overflows).

The word life here is the Greek word, Zoe, which means "absolute fullness of life" or life as God has it in Himself! Believers in Jesus Christ have this Zoe life inside. God's life! John's Epistle tells us this:

I Jn 5:11-12
And this is the record, that God hath given to us eternal life, and this life is in his Son.12 He that hath the Son hath life; and he that hath not the Son of God hath not life.(KJV)

This is that same life (Zoe). If you have the Son, if you have received Jesus as your personal Savior, then you have that same life in you!
